Our tangy drink is a tribute to Kamehameha\u2019s battlecry uttered before doing battle with the Maui warriors at \u02bb\u012aao, \u201c I mua e n\u0101 p\u014dki\u02bbi a inu i ka wai \u02bbawa\u02bbawa. \u02bbA\u02bbohe hope e ho\u02bbi ai. \u2013 Go forward &#038; drink the bitter waters. There is no turning back. $2.50<\/p>\n<p>Dressed for the Coronation Ball <\/p>\n<p>Lusciously sweet Kula strawberries dressed in tuxedos of dark and white chocolate. Accompanied by a lovely Swiss champagne truffle.  <\/p>\n<p>Built by Kal\u0101kaua in 1882, the palace stood as a constant reminder to Hawaiians that we are somebody and that we stand on par with other nations of the world.  If \u2018Iolani Palace was a dessert this is what it would taste like. $ 4.50<\/p>\n","protected":false},"excerpt":{"rendered":"<p>Remember to connect your dish with your historical fact!
